Got a problem with my focus it’s a 2003 1.6

It’s either Gearbox related or clutch related if the later it’s under warranty but I’m getting conflicting reports on which one it is.

With the car Idling and in neutral if you press the clutch pedal to the floor then release the pedal fairly quick the gearbox knocks and rattles loud enough to hear it inside the cabin.

If you do the same but release the pedal slowly there is no noise.

Occasional; there is the rattle knocking when at cold start, it’s like something is unsettling a bearing or something inside the gearbox or clutch.

Anybody know if this is clutch related or Gearbox related.

Focus's are fitted with a concentric slave cylinder which is a release bearing and slave cylinder in one and its very unlikely for that to be the noise your describing.

If the knock is heavy then i would start with checking the gearbox mounting.
